The Battle of Britain (2010) is a fascinating dive into a pivotal moment in history, narrated by the McGregor brothers. Their personal touch as they fly historic planes really adds to the atmosphere, making it feel more like a journey than just a dry retelling of events. The pacing is engaging, mixing the veterans' firsthand accounts with stunning aerial visuals. What's striking here is the blend of technology and human spirit; you really get a sense of what those pilots faced. The documentary doesn't shy away from the harsh realities of war but balances that with an appreciation for the bravery shown during those trying times. The practical effects used for the planes enhance the experience, giving it an authenticity that's hard to come by.
Features interviews with veteran pilots.Captivating aerial footage of historic aircraft.Explores both tactics and technology used during the battle.
